Saints' Niko Lalos: Returns to action
Lalos (groin) played in the Saints' preseason game against the Texans on Sunday.
Lalos has previously missed time due to the injury, but he was able to suit up for the contest, seeing 26 snaps on defense. The 26-year-old recorded two total tackles, including a sack, in the game.

Saints' Niko Lalos: Misses practice
Lalos missed Tuesday's practice while dealing with a groin injury, Mike Triplett of NewOrleans.Football reports.
Head coach Dennis Allen noted that the team doesn't expect the injury to be serious. Lalos is coming off an impressive performance in the Saints' 22-17 preseason win over the Chargers on Sunday when he tallied five tackles and three sacks in just 27 defensive snaps. The injury is a setback on his quest to make the Saints' final 53-man roster as he competes for a depth spot behind defensive linemen Isaiah Foskey, Tanoh Kpassagnon and Kyle Phillips.

Saints' Niko Lalos: Tallies three sacks Sunday
Lalos recorded five tackles, including three sacks, and one pass defended during Sunday's 22-17 preseason win against the Chargers.
Lalos filled up the box score during his limited playing time, as he finished with 27 defensive snaps -- all of which were played during the second half. The 26-year-old dominated on the Chargers' final offensive series of the game, recording a pass deflection before collecting back-to-back sacks on quarterback Easton Stick. Lalos spent time on the Saints' practice squad last season before playing 10 games with the Seattle Sea Dragons of the XFL. The 6-foot-5, 270-pound defensive end is still a massive longshot to make a final 53-man roster, but his notable growth this preseason may help him secure a spot on the practice squad heading into the regular season.

Giants' Niko Lalos: Heading to New York
Lalos signed a contract with the Giants on Tuesday, Art Stapleton of NorthJersey.com reports.
Lalos has already spent time on the Giants' practice squad this season so he could be in line to see some game action Sunday against the Cardinals.
